Output 624af52d4ba247f36769d75801718d1b0b27386f01c475e1c6f810360c130a96:1

value
22890000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b51f658fb9cbfed830ba282ea57683301c03f8c9 OP_EQUAL
address
A8wxabPSyGKmhtZ6uCELX8Yaije5QiJ3XR
transaction
624af52d4ba247f36769d75801718d1b0b27386f01c475e1c6f810360c130a96